java.lang.Object
java.lang.Enum<Language>
co.elastic.clients.elasticsearch._types.analysis.Language
All Implemented Interfaces:
JsonEnum, JsonpSerializable, java.io.Serializable, java.lang.Comparable<Language>, java.lang.constant.Constable

@JsonpDeserializable
public enum Language
extends java.lang.Enum<Language>
implements JsonEnum
See Also:
API specification
  • Enum Constant Details

    • Arabic

      public static final Language Arabic
    • Armenian

      public static final Language Armenian
    • Basque

      public static final Language Basque
    • Brazilian

      public static final Language Brazilian
    • Bulgarian

      public static final Language Bulgarian
    • Catalan

      public static final Language Catalan
    • Chinese

      public static final Language Chinese
    • Cjk

      public static final Language Cjk
    • Czech

      public static final Language Czech
    • Danish

      public static final Language Danish
    • Dutch

      public static final Language Dutch
    • English

      public static final Language English
    • Estonian

      public static final Language Estonian
    • Finnish

      public static final Language Finnish
    • French

      public static final Language French
    • Galician

      public static final Language Galician
    • German

      public static final Language German
    • Greek

      public static final Language Greek
    • Hindi

      public static final Language Hindi
    • Hungarian

      public static final Language Hungarian
    • Indonesian

      public static final Language Indonesian
    • Irish

      public static final Language Irish
    • Italian

      public static final Language Italian
    • Latvian

      public static final Language Latvian
    • Norwegian

      public static final Language Norwegian
    • Persian

      public static final Language Persian
    • Portuguese

      public static final Language Portuguese
    • Romanian

      public static final Language Romanian
    • Russian

      public static final Language Russian
    • Sorani

      public static final Language Sorani
    • Spanish

      public static final Language Spanish
    • Swedish

      public static final Language Swedish
    • Turkish

      public static final Language Turkish
    • Thai

      public static final Language Thai
  • Field Details

  • Method Details

    • values

      public static Language[] values()
      Returns an array containing the constants of this enum type, in the order they are declared.
      Returns:
      an array containing the constants of this enum type, in the order they are declared
    • valueOf

      public static Language valueOf​(java.lang.String name)
      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)
      Parameters:
      name - the name of the enum constant to be returned.
      Returns:
      the enum constant with the specified name
      Throws:
      java.lang.IllegalArgumentException - if this enum type has no constant with the specified name
      java.lang.NullPointerException - if the argument is null
    • jsonValue

      public java.lang.String jsonValue()
      Specified by:
      jsonValue in interface JsonEnum